Ex-Wizard Satoransky selected to bear Czech flag at Olympics originally appeared on NBC Sports Washington
Former Wizard and Czech national team guard Tomas Satoransky will be a flag-bearer for the Czech Republic in the upcoming 2021 Olympic Games, the Czech Committee announced on Thursday.

Satoransky was selected by his fellow Czech Olympians alongside two-time Wimbledon champion Petra Kvitova.
The 29-year-old Chicago Bulls star helped the team reach the Olympics for the first time, winning MVP at the Qualifiers of Victoria, Canada. In 2019, the five-time Czech Player of the Year helped the country to its first FIBA World Cup appearance.
Satoransky was drafted in the second round of the 2012 NBA Draft by the Wizards, where he played for three seasons after a stint in Spain. He was traded to the Bulls in 2019.
Satoransky and the Czech national basketball team will tip off against Iran in Group A on Saturday.
